Acrobat Reader 7.0 problems...

Featured Replies

Hey guys

I'm installing Acrobat Reader 7.0 as part of my unattended setup and I get a very annoying dialog box during the setup that says "The following applications should be closed before continuing the installation: Windows XP Setup". I have to hit the ignore button to finish my installation.

Here's how i'm running the setup

ECHO Installing Adobe Acrobat 7.0 Reader
start "ACROBAT0" /wait "tools\AdbeRdr70_enu_full.exe" /w /v"/qb EULA_ACCEPT=YES"
ECHO Installing Adobe Acrobat 7.0.1 Update
start "ACROBAT1" /wait "tools\Acro-Reader_701_update.exe" /w /v"/qb"
ECHO Installing Adobe Acrobat 7.0.2 Update
start "ACROBAT2" /wait "tools\Acro-Reader_702_update.exe" /w /v"/qb"
ECHO Installing Adobe Acrobat 7.0.3 Update
start "ACROBAT3" /wait "tools\Acro-Reader_703_update.exe" /w /v"/qb"

I've included a screenshot.

Thanks!
